The New Mahindra Bolero Neo: The BOSS, Reimagined
Overview: The Next Evolution of an Icon
The Mahindra Bolero Neo represents the modern evolution of India's most trusted SUV. Originally launched in 2015 as the TUV300, it was reimagined and relaunched as the Bolero Neo in July 2021 to bring modern features and premium design to the legendary Bolero family.
The Bolero Neo is built on the same 3rd generation chassis as the Scorpio and Thar, offering a tough, body-on-frame construction and rear-wheel-drive credentials. Performance: The Power to Rule
The Bolero Neo is engineered to deliver power, efficiency, and all-terrain capability.
Powerful mHawk100 Engine: The heart of the Neo is its mHawk100 1.5-litre, 1493 cc BSVI diesel engine. It delivers an impressive 73.5 kW (100 bhp) of power and 260 Nm of torque.
Multi-Terrain Technology (MTT): Tackle any road with ease. Standard on the N10 (O) and N11, MTT (Mechanical Locking Differential) intelligently distributes torque to maintain traction and control, even on muddy trails or unpredictable roads.
Fuel Efficiency Mode: Get both power and economy. The engine features advanced Engine Stop/Start (ESS) and an ECO Mode to optimize fuel efficiency.
Rear-Wheel Drive: Paired with a robust body-on-frame chassis, the rear-wheel-drive setup ensures confident handling and solid performance across every terrain.

Variants and Key Differences
Bolero Neo N4: The authentic and tough entry point. Features the powerful mHawk100 engine, Body-on-Frame chassis, Power Steering, Power Windows, and all standard safety features including Dual Airbags and ABS with EBD.
Bolero Neo N8: Adds more style and convenience. Includes body-coloured bumpers, signature side cladding, wheel arch cladding, a 2-DIN music system, and remote key entry.
Bolero Neo N10: The premium choice. Adds sporty static bending headlamps with DRLs, stylish silver alloy wheels, a 22.8 cm touchscreen, Cruise Control, and steering-mounted audio controls.
Bolero Neo N10 (O) & N11: The ultimate BOSS. These top-tier models include all features of the N10 and add the critical Multi-Terrain Technology (MTT) for enhanced off-road capability. The N11 further adds premium Leatherette Upholstery, larger R16 Alloy Wheels, and a Rear View Camera.

Technical Specifications
Engine: mHAWK100 1493 cc BSVI Diesel
Maximum Power: 73.5 kW @ 3750 rpm
Maximum Torque: 260 Nm @ 1750-2250 rpm
Transmission: 5-Speed Manual
Suspension Front: Double Wishbone with Coil Spring
Suspension Rear: Multi-Link with Coil spring
Brakes Front: Disc
Brakes Rear: Drum
Dimensions (L x W x H): 3995 mm x 1795 mm x 1817 mm
Wheel Base: 2680 mm
Seating Capacity: 7 seats (5+2 configuration)
Fuel Tank Capacity: 50 L
Tyres: 215/75 R15 (N11: 215/70 R16)
Warranty: 3 Years

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What is the difference between the Bolero and the Bolero Neo? The Bolero Neo is the modern, more premium version of the Bolero. While both are tough 7-seaters, the Neo has a more powerful 100 bhp engine (vs. the Bolero's 75 bhp),a more modern interior, a smoother coil spring suspension (vs. leaf springs),and more advanced features like a touchscreen and Multi-Terrain Technology.
2. What is Multi-Terrain Technology (MTT)? MTT is Mahindra's name for the Mechanical Locking Differential (MLD) available in the N10 (O) and N11 variants. This system automatically locks the rear differential if one wheel starts to spin, sending power to the wheel that has traction. This makes it much more capable on bad roads, mud, and uneven terrain than a standard 2WD SUV.
3. Is the Bolero Neo a 4x4? No, the Bolero Neo is a Rear-Wheel Drive (RWD) SUV. However, the Multi-Terrain Technology (MTT) gives it enhanced capability in low-traction situations, making it a "tough-roader".
4. What is the mileage of the Bolero Neo? The ARAI-certified mileage for the Bolero Neo is 17.29 kmpl. Real-world mileage may vary based on driving conditions and maintenance.
5. What is the seating capacity? The Bolero Neo is a 7-seater SUV with a (5+2) configuration. This means it has 5 standard front-facing seats (2 in front, 3 in the middle) and 2 side-facing jump seats in the rear.
6. What is the safety rating of the Bolero Neo? The Bolero Neo was tested by Global NCAP and received a 1-star rating for adult and child occupant protection. It comes standard with essential safety features like Dual Airbags, ABS with EBD, and Cornering Brake Control.
7. Does the Bolero Neo have an automatic transmission? No, the Bolero Neo is currently only available with a 5-speed manual transmission.
8. What is the ground clearance? The Mahindra Bolero Neo has an unladen ground clearance of 180 mm, making it suitable for handling rough Indian roads.
